The Rising Phenomenon of Musical Metaphors in Contemporary Pop

Music has long served as a canvas for creative expression, but today’s pop songs often weave intricate metaphors into their lyrics, inviting audiences to dive into multi-layered messages. Go-Jo’s “Milkshake Man,” representing Australia at Eurovision 2025, is a vibrant example of this trend. Through its lively beats and metaphor-rich lyrics, the song captures both self-expression and playful innuendo, echoing broader trends in the music industry.

Understanding Dual Narratives in Music

One fascinating trend in music is the use of dual narratives. Artists like Go-Jo employ this by crafting songs with multiple interpretations. In “Milkshake Man,” the upbeat melody and catchy choruses belie a deeper message of self-acceptance and individuality. On the surface, the song appears playful and light-hearted, but it also harbors themes of empowerment and self-expression. This duality resonates with listeners, offering them both entertainment and a chance for introspection.

Reaching Across Audiences and Cultures

In the age of globalization, music acts as a bridge between diverse cultures. Go-Jo’s French-Australian background and his incorporation of French lyrics in “Milkshake Man” reflect this blending of cultures. This trend of cultural fusion is becoming increasingly prevalent in modern pop, as artists draw on their heritage to create unique sounds and stories that appeal to a global audience.

The Role of Social Media in Shaping Music Trends

Social media platforms like Instagram and YouTube are instrumental in popularizing new music trends and artists. Go-Jo’s decision to explain the meaning behind “Milkshake Man” on Instagram highlights the importance of engaging directly with fans. By sharing behind-the-scenes insights, artists create a deeper connection with their audience, fostering loyalty and expanding their reach.

Metaphors and Literalism: A Balancing Act

Creating a successful pop song often involves balancing metaphorical lyrics with literal themes. Alongside self-expression, “Milkshake Man” contains playful sexual innuendos, making it accessible on multiple levels. This balance is crucial for attracting a wide audience while maintaining artistic integrity.
